Model Optimization
Bridge the gap between research and production. We utilize advanced compression techniques like quantization and pruning to deploy heavy deep learning models onto edge devices and mobile platforms without sacrificing inference speed or accuracy.
- Int8 & FP16 Model Quantization
- Structured & Unstructured Pruning
- Knowledge Distillation for Lite Models
- TensorRT & ONNX Runtime Acceleration

Deep learning is a subset of machine learning that uses multi-layered neural networks to automatically learn hierarchical representations from data. It excels at complex tasks like image recognition, NLP, and speech processing where traditional ML may fall short.
